Francis Bivins
Francis Ellery Bivins, 90, longtime Sawyer area farmer, died Tuesday, January 15, 2013 in a Minot Nursing Home. Francis was born December 25, 1922 in Willis Township of Ward County, North Dakota, the son of Donald and Leona Marvel (Baker) Bivins. He was raised and educated at rural schools in Willis Township and graduated from Minot High School in 1940. He attended North Dakota State University in Fargo for two years and was united in marriage to Joan Laskowski on June 10, 1951 at Minot.

Alvina Hammes
Alvina Hammes, age 90, of Underwood, ND, formerly of Sykeston, ND, died Tuesday, January 15, 2013, at Sanford Health in Bismarck, ND. Alvina Neumiller was born on September 6, 1922, the daughter of Christian and Mathilda (Morlock) Neumiller on a farm in Kidder County near Heaton, ND. She attended Cottonwood School north of Heaton and graduated from Sykeston High School.

Elsa Barry
Elsa Barry, 104, formerly of Bismarck, died on January 13, 2013, at Elm Crest Nursing Home in New Salem, ND. Elsa Othelia Kutz was born to Adolf and Amelia (Boehlke) Kutz on Feb. 14, 1908, near Sykeston, ND. Elsa attended high school in Sykeston and worked at Corson’s General Store. She enjoyed Saturday night dances, doing the Charleston, and riding in a Model-T.

Marjorie Froehlich
Marjorie Ann Froehlich, 65, Marion, ND, died Friday, January 11, 2013 at Sanford Health in Fargo, ND. Marjorie Ann Beyer was born October 6, 1947 in Jamestown, ND, the daughter of Lawrence and Elsie (Brimer) Beyer. She was raised on a farm by Dickey, ND, where she attended Saratoga Country School and then she went to Dickey School. After awhile they moved to a farm by Montpelier, ND, where she graduated from high school in 1965.

Aaron Swartz
NEW YORK (AP) — Computer prodigy Aaron Swartz, who helped develop RSS and co-founded Reddit, has been found dead weeks before he was to go on trial on federal charges that he stole millions of scholarly articles in an attempt to make them freely available to the public.

Albert Wiest
Al Wiest, retired US Army Colonel, died peacefully but unexpectedly at the age of 98 on December 30th, 2012, in his home in Beachcrest, rural Olympia, WA. He was born on August 22, 1914, in Jamestown, ND, where he came to be called “Bill”, to couple him with his identical twin brother Bob.
